  • A sample survey of 344 households in the district which elicited demographic data and information about certain attitudes .
  • A study of the membership, aims and activities of formal groups located in the area .
  • Data for this study were collected through our participation with the members of the Civic Group, other local leaders and residents, as well as analysis of documents, particularly of the local newspaper .
  • A broad investigation of the welfare problems of the residents during a two-month period. Federal, State and voluntary agencies participated. At the local level, welfare was interpreted widely to include such problems as those dealt with by ministers of religion and the infant welfare sister as well as those encountered by social workers .
